Process of Creating a Well-Developed Shopify Store

Here is a brief explanation of each step you must carefully follow to set up a well-designed and customizable Shopify website for your business.

Getting Started with Shopify

First, you need to start with Shopify by creating your online store on it. The process begins by signing up for a Shopify account. You must enter vital information like your email address, store name, password, and more to do this.

After creating your account on Shopify, you need to choose its plan. Shopify offers multiple plans according to business size and need. You can also use a free trial plan to familiarise yourself with its functioning. After that, you need to choose your domain name.

Customizing Your Shopify Store

Customization means giving a unique look and style to your store. It reflects your brand niche and standard. It’s essential to design your online store to look different and attract customers. You can start by choosing a suitable theme for your store. Out of many paid and free options, you can choose a theme and layout for your store that matches your product style.

Additionally, you can customize your themes with different color fonts and make them unique. Also, you can easily add the logo in the header section. Now, it’s time to add products to your store.

Adding Products to Your Shopify Store

In this process, you have to add products to your Shopify store. It involves creating listings for items you want to sell. You will need to add titles of each product, such as their name, price, size, images, description, and more. Afterward, organize your products into proper categories to help consumers buy them. Payment and Shipping Settings

Being an e-commerce store owner, you need to incorporate multiple payment methods. Shopify offers payment options such as PayPal, credit card, and more. It will allow you to accept customer payments and ensure a smooth buyer payment process. All these things will help you improve the user experience.

Search Engine Optimization (SEO)

You can’t expect a good result even if you have implemented all the strategies but not SEO. Your store’s search engine ranking highly affects your brand’s success. You can only improve it by practicing SEO regularly. It involves working on content structure, creating informative content, optimizing product descriptions and titles with relevant keywords, and more.

Analytics and Reporting

Analytical tools help you track your business performance and provide you with valuable insights into various aspects. It enables you to track sales, visitor behavior, and conversion rates. You can make better decisions for your business’s future after reporting and monitoring your website traffic, customer demographics, and product performance.

Launching Your Shopify Store

At last, it’s time to launch your product in the market. But before launch, conduct testing of your whole website and test the performance of everything. It involves checking the website functionality, payment options, and shipping settings.
